Born on November 9, 1983, in Seoul, South Korea, Um Tae-goo did not always envision himself as a superstar. Growing up in a creative household, he was the younger brother of Um Tae-hwa, who would eventually become a prominent film director. This familial bond proved crucial to his early career. Um Tae-goo attended the prestigious Konkuk University, majoring in Film, where he honed his craft and developed the quiet, introspective approach to acting that has since become his trademark. Unlike many actors who seek the spotlight immediately, he spent years in minor roles, often appearing in his brother's independent shorts, which helped build his reputation as a dedicated and hardworking performer.
His career milestones are marked by a slow-burn rise to the top. While he appeared in major productions like The Silenced (2015), it was his chilling performance in the 2016 period action film The Age of Shadows that served as his breakthrough. Playing the relentless Japanese police officer Hashimoto, he held his own alongside legends like Song Kang-ho. This role showcased his ability to play villains with a terrifying, understated intensity. His performance earned him widespread recognition and several nominations at major awards shows, establishing him as a top-tier talent in the industry. Other notable works include his role in A Taxi Driver (2017) and the cult hit Save Me 2 (2019), where he displayed his range in a high-stakes television setting.
However, the project that truly cemented his status as a cinematic powerhouse was the 2020 Netflix film Night in Paradise. Premiering at the Venice International Film Festival, the film featured Um Tae-goo as a tragic mobster on the run. His performance was lauded by international critics, who compared his brooding intensity to the icons of classic American noir. By 2024, he surprised the world by taking on a lead role in the romantic comedy My Sweet Mobster. The show was a massive hit in the United States and across streaming platforms like Viki and Hulu, as fans fell in love with his character's awkward charm and soft heart hidden behind a tough exterior. This shift significantly boosted the Um Tae-goo net worth and his commercial viability, leading to numerous brand endorsements and magazine covers in 2025 and 2026.
In his personal life, Um Tae-goo is famously shy and introverted, a sharp contrast to the aggressive characters he often portrays. He has mentioned in interviews that he enjoys quiet hobbies like drawing and spending time with his close-knit family. Regarding his current relationship status, he remains single and highly private about his dating life, preferring to keep the focus on his artistic output. He is also known for his humility and is frequently praised by costars for his kindness on set. There are no major controversies associated with him; instead, he is celebrated for his professionalism and his philanthropic contributions to various youth arts programs in Korea.
